Neon Color Run/Walk
Central Mountain Majorettes ReliaQuest Team will be having a Neon Color Run/Walk on Aug. 8 at 7:30 p.m. at the Central Mountain High School campus. The majorette team is raising funds to help with their traveling to Tampa in December to perform during the pregame and halftime show at the ReliaQuest Bowl Game. The majorettes are ready for some color blasting and fun entertainment, and want a lot of participants to come out to this event. Register before July 18 to get a T-shirt. Help Helping Hands Help Others
Helping Hands at United Lutheran Church is a non profit program that helps low income families and senior citizens with items such as toilet paper, paper towels, shampoo, soap, laundry care, cleaning items, ect. They will be closed for the month of July, but will reopen the third Wednesday in August. Any questions, please feel free to call Kelly Olmstead at 272-209-5912. Donations of any items (or financial support for us to buy items) will be a tremendous help for the program.
